الفرق بين ريك وخدمة ويب الفرق بين

Anonim

ريك مقابل خدمة ويب

يتطلب إنشاء خدمات الويب باستخدام بروتوكول سواب أي من بدائلتين لاستخدامهما. يمكن للمرء إما اتباع بروتوكول سواب المستند أو بروتوكول المراسلة سواب ريك. ريك يشير إلى استدعاء الإجراء البعيد وهو بروتوكول التي يمكن استخدامها من قبل برنامج معين لطلب خدمة معينة في برنامج آخر يقع داخل كمبيوتر بعيد آخر. عند استخدام ريك، ليست هناك حاجة لمعرفة تفاصيل الشبكة من البرنامج. يشار إلى استدعاء إجراء معين على أنه مكالمة روتينية فرعية أو حتى استدعاء دالة.

في استخدام ريك، هناك استخدام كثيف لنموذج العميل / الخادم. البرنامج الذي يطلب خدمة يتم تنفيذها على جانب العميل والكمبيوتر توفير تنفيذ برنامج معين يقال أن يكون على نهاية الملقم. يمكن وصف العمل ريك متزامن، حيث أنه يتطلب برنامج الذي يطلب إجراء لإيقاف الإجراء المحدد حتى يتم إعطاء وقت إجراء نتائج إجراء بعيد.

للتأكد من أن الجهاز لا يستغرق وقتا طويلا عندما تكون هناك إجراءات مختلفة معلقة، يسمح ريك لمعالجة مؤشرات الترابط المتعددة التي تشترك في عنوان معين، وبالتالي يمكن إعطاء الردود كما أنها تأتي ، وليس في سلسلة حيث يجب أن تكتمل عمل واحد للالقادم للبدء.

خدمة ويب التي تم إنشاؤها باستخدام عنصر تحكم سواب يمكن بالتالي اتباع ريك أو أسلوب مراسلة المستند. ومن ثم يمكن أن يشير نمط الوثيقة إلى محدد. وثيقة شمل التي يمكن التحقق من صحتها مع مخطط شمل معين. كما يتم استخدام جافا ريك في الاتصال من منصات مثل إجب هو، تطبيقات مماثلة تعمل على جافا. خدمة ويب، من ناحية أخرى، يستخدم أساسا كلما كان هناك استخدام التطبيق الذي لا يعمل على جافا ويسعى للاتصال مع خدمة ويب.

الأداء بين ريك و ويب سيرفيسز متميز تماما، مع اختلاف كبير بين خدمات الويب و ريك متغير تماما. وفي بعض الحالات، يمكن أن يكون الاختلاف صغيرا جدا، مع الأخذ بعين الاعتبار القدرة على الصمود. ريك يأتي مع التحدي المتمثل في وجود بيئة الخادم المزدحمة، الأمر الذي يجعل من الصعب جدا بالنسبة لك للعمل مع عملاء متعددة.

من ناحية أخرى، تسمح خدمة ويب بنشر متعددة للخدمة، مع الحاجة فقط إلى أن يتم استدعاء خدمة ويب عبر هتب. هذا يسمح لاستغلال الشبكة العادية الرش وتقنيات التوجيه المستخدمة في مواقع أكبر. ومن المهم أيضا أن نلاحظ أن خدمة ويب لا تحتاج إلى أي ترميز خاص للعمل مع الخادم أو حتى العميل.

يمكن مقارنة مرونة كل من ريك وخدمة ويب بالتساوي، على الرغم من أنه من المهم ملاحظة أن ريك يتطلب استخدام الوسطاء كما هو متوقع.ومن هنا أن إي إجب وأطر مثل الربيع تأتي في اللعب. للحصول على الأفضل في الخدمة، فمن المستحسن للعمل مع جافا إي إجب أولا قبل جلب بيئة ريك. التعرض لخدمة ويب لهذه البيئة و ريك أيضا يجعل التكوين أسهل بكثير.

الملخص

يشير ريك إلى استدعاء الإجراء البعيد.

يوصى باستخدام ريك عندما يكون هناك استخدام كثيف لنموذج العميل / الخادم.

ريك يسمح بمعالجة المواضيع المتعددة التي تشارك عنوان معين.

يعمل ريك على منصة تستخدم إجب.

خدمة الويب المستخدمة في منصات غير جافا عندما يريد التطبيق الوصول.

كما تستخدم خدمة الويب لمزامنة الاتصالات غير المتزامنة.